Quote:
Originally Posted by UtnaH View Post
hey , I heard something about co-op/internship within the lifescience program, so how does one get into that and in what year?
And if I'm going into the bachelors of life science program year I, how does one get into the honors program?
There is no co-op for life sciences (according to the undergraduate calendar). There is co-op for other programs though, just browse through the undergrad calendar, co-op programs have "(co-op)" at the end of them.

To get into honours, just meet all the requirements and go to the science office to get transfered. Unless you mean applying to Honour Life Science after First Year. Then that happens in March, I think you can apply to 3 different programs. Then you select which one you want to get into when you pick your courses for second year.
